The Vertical Tube Holder for Aquarium keeps maintenance hoses securely positioned during water changes, tank cleaning and other routine aquarium work. Its glass-clip mounting design allows quick installation without suction cups or permanent fittings.
This holder supports hoses with an outer diameter from 12mm to 19mm. It keeps the hose in a vertical position and helps prevent it from slipping, moving or falling out of the aquarium while water is being drained or added.
The glass clip attaches directly to the aquarium edge, while the upper holder keeps the maintenance hose organised. This makes aquarium maintenance easier and reduces the need to hold the hose by hand throughout the process.
The Vertical Tube Holder for Aquarium is useful during partial water changes, substrate cleaning, aquarium filling and drainage. It can also help direct the hose into a suitable position while maintaining better control over water flow.
Its compact design takes up minimal space and can be removed easily after use. The holder is suitable for freshwater aquariums, marine tanks, planted aquariums and other glass aquarium setups.
Each package contains one vertical tube holder. Check the hose diameter before installation to ensure it falls within the supported 12–19mm range.
